| Summary: | Cancer is among the leading causes of mortality across the globe. Despite the development of wide variety of oncotherapeutics, the effectiveness of oncotherapeutic drugs and anti-cancer bioactive compounds is frequently hindered by their low solubility and poor bioavailability, highlighting the need for efficient drug delivery system. Cyclodextrin (CD), a cyclic oligosaccharide produced by amylase hydrolysis of starch has emerged as promising candidates for drug delivery system due to their unique properties and low toxicity profile. This review comprehensively discussed the structure and properties of CD and its derivatives, as well as elucidated the synthesis and characterization of different types of CD-based drug delivery system including inclusion complex, nanoparticles, nanosponges, nanofibers, micelles, liposomes and hydrogels. The application of CD-based drug delivery system for oncotherapeutics was discussed and a forward-looking perspective on the challenges and prospects of CD-based drug delivery system demonstrated. |
